We're seeking a Site Reliability Engineer for a team focused on monitoring, incident management, reliability engineering, automation, and proactive system optimization for our critical banking infrastructure and services.
Contribute to the development and maintenance of FNBO's monitoring ecosystem. This includes implementing monitoring frameworks, dashboards, alerting, and tooling for proactive issue detection and resolution, plus advancing monitoring-as-code practices. Partner with application and platform teams to improve service reliability, observability, and overall system health. Support the growth and evolution of the Site Reliability Engineering practice at FNBO, embracing engineering-first approaches to operational challenges. Participate in incident response for high-severity events, contributing technical expertise to drive rapid resolution and minimize customer impact. Apply infrastructure-as-code principles to improve consistency, repeatability, and scalability. Identify and reduce toil through automation and process improvement, freeing capacity for higher-value engineering work. Participate in post-incident reviews and support the implementation of corrective and preventive actions. Assist in analyzing system performance trends and capacity utilization, helping surface actionable improvement opportunities.
Compensation range (base pay): $79,363.00-$130,949.00. This role may have a specific starting pay within this range. Final compensation offer to candidate may vary from posted hiring range based upon work experience, education, and/or skill level.
It is anticipated that the incumbent in this role will work in a hybrid capacity, balancing in-person collaboration three (3) days a week with remote flexibility two (2) days a week.
